I agree that bringing in more guys than positions creates an odd situation (you pretty much know that half the guys in the group won't ever get a chance to start) but I don't know that it prevents you from landing commits. Stanford had 4 linemen in the fold (three 4-stars) and was still able to add Garnett late and two 5-stars on signing day. Who knows if taking that many guys at one position will end up being good business, but cold feet didn't seem to be an issue.
I'm guessing (much like with kids admitted to law school all thinking they will finish in the top 25% of their class) that most recruits think they will end up playing no matter how many other players are in the fold. Or at least they can be talked into thinking that way.

The coaches were clearly prepared to take 6-7 guys in the 2012 class but ended up with only 4 (so far). After next season we lose at least 4 offensive linemen to graduation (Lewan will definitely get NFL interest as well).
Just to tread water we need to take 4-5 and Coach Hoke has talked about wanting to lift the overall numbers to 14-16 (we'll have 12 in 2012). Considering the offers that are still out there, I'm pretty sure we'd take one or two more blue-chip guys if they wanted to commit.
